Job description

Essential Functions

  • Serves as the primary point of contact for plan sponsors, advisors and internal Newport teams to successfully on-board client plans onto Newport platform.
  • Identifies, creates, and executes efficient project timeline and client facing deliverables.
  • Works with plan sponsors, internal / external consultants, and prior service providers to successfully convert plan data, assets and liabilities.
  • Schedules and leads weekly checkpoint calls with clients and external partners to provide project status update and to discuss open items. Maintains and organizes client-meeting materials such as agenda, minutes and timeline.
  • Understands legal plan documents, implementation process and translates client requests into actionable tasks.
  • Research and understands client on-boarding process, plan setup and project documentation needs. Works closely with cross-functional support teams to resolve system setup and configuration issues.
  • Takes ownership and facilitates resolutions to client questions / issues using the available internal and external resources.
  • Prepares client data with use of Excel formulas / tools, including but not limited to : data extracts, data formatting, data manipulation and editing to ensure completeness and accuracy to ensure compliance with contractual requirement and client expectation.
  • Prepares the necessary documentations for initial plan set up and provide post implementation assistance by developing accurate and detailed administration manuals outlining processes and procedures related to the project / case.
  • Manages multiple case assignments, different clients, changing priorities to manage and prioritize project needs.
